21xrx.com
2024-11-22 07:49:24 Friday
登录
文章检索 我的文章 写文章
C++上机考试试题复试
2023-07-03 22:08:09 深夜i     --     --
C++ 上机考试 试题 复试 编程题

近日,一份关于C++上机考试试题的复试问题引起了广泛关注。据悉,这道考题曾在某校C++课程的期末考试上出现,成为了不少考生考试的难点。

该试题要求考生完成一个关于字符串的加密解密程序。首先,考生需要编写一个函数,将输入的明文字符串加密。该函数的输入为明文字符串,输出为加密后的密文字符串。加密规则是:将字符串中的每个字符转换成其对应的ASCII码值加上一个随机数,并将所得到的结果转换为ASCII字符,然后将所有字符拼接在一起成为一个新的字符串。其次,考生还需要编写一个函数,将加密后的密文字符串解密,恢复成明文字符串。解密规则为加密规则的逆运算,即将每个字符的ASCII值减去随机数后再转换为字符。

这道考题对于C++编程语言的掌握程度要求较高,考生需要熟练掌握字符串的处理方法、变量的类型和运算、函数的定义和调用等基本知识。同时,考生还需要具备较强的分析问题和解决问题的能力,能够独立思考和实现所需的算法。

针对这道考题,一些学生表达了不同的看法。有些同学认为这是一道很好的考题,能够检验学生对C++编程语言的掌握和应用能力。而另外一些同学则表示该考题难度较大,需要耗费较长时间才能完成。

总之,这道C++上机考试试题的确是一道较难的题目,需要考生在实际操作中充分发挥自己的编程能力和思维能力,才能顺利完成。在接下来的学习中,希望广大学生们能够注重基础知识的掌握,提高编程能力和算法思维,以更好地应对未来的挑战。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复